Job Overview

Talkishco is seeking a skilled Communications Representative to join our team. As a key member of our organization, you will be responsible for managing internal and external communications, ensuring consistent messaging, and enhancing our company brand image.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and implement communication strategies and campaigns to engage our audience and promote our brand.
  • Create and distribute content such as press releases, newsletters, and social media posts to maintain a strong online presence.
  • Manage media relations, including responding to inquiries and arranging interviews to showcase our company expertise.
  • Maintain our company website and social media platforms to ensure a cohesive brand image.
  • Coordinate with other departments to ensure consistent messaging and alignment with our company goals.
  • Monitor and analyze communication metrics to assess the effectiveness of our campaigns and make data-driven decisions.
  • Plan and execute internal communications initiatives to keep employees informed and engaged.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Communications, Public Relations, Journalism, or a related field.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ills to effectively convey our company message.
  • Strong project management and organizational abilities to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and content management systems to efficiently manage our online presence.
  • Experience with social media management and digital marketing tools to stay up-to-date with industry trends.
What We Offer
  • Competitive salary and benefits package.
  • Opportunities for professional development and growth within our company.
  • A dynamic and supportive work environment that fosters collaboration and innovation.
